  • We have a lower budget for our flowers... about $1,500. We are using Leah from It's So Ranunculus. Leah is AMAZING and is including a bunch of random stuff for us, like allowing us to borrow her two antique ladders as decor and hanging her old window frames from trees. Our quote of $1,200 included flowers for me, 5 bridesmaids, 2 mothers, 1 grandmother, 2 dads, 1 grandfather, and 18 centerpieces in mason jars. Plus flowers on our additional tables. I think her quote is unbelieveable and we booked her on the spot. We also met with Stylish Blooms and while her quote was lower, Leah offered more non-floral options for us that we loved.

  • We also wanted to keep our budget for flowers at under $1500.  We are using Melissa at Stylish Blooms. She came in under our budget and we are getting flowers for me, 6 bridesmaids, 5 Groomsmen, my grandmother, 2 moms, 2 dads, 1 grandfather,  ring bearer and 15 centerpeices.  She had some really great ideas on ways we could get the look we wanted but stay under budget.

  • We're spending just about $5,000 on flowers. The majority of that cost is from my centerpieces. I wanted big, tall centerpieces with just white roses and white hydrangeas (no greens and no fillers). We have about 15 guest tables. We're also getting flowers for the cocktail hour tables, escort card table, church, and all of the wedding party and parents. We're using Candi's Creations and she is absolutely amazing.

  • I'm also going with Melissa at Stylish Blooms.  For myself, 7 bridesmaids, 7 groomsmen, 2 flower girls, 3 ring bearers, parents of the bride, parents of the groom, the officiant, ceremony flowers, something for the head table and escort card table, she came in at about $1000. I am going to just use lanterns with a candle for centerpieces on all of the other tables.  So far, Melissa is great to work with and has been helpful in figuring out ways to stay within our budget.

  • We are using Jane at Just For You. Originally, our price was at about $1500 but I changed some things and added in more expensive flowers. Our price now is $2400.

    We are getting: 6 BM bouquets, Bridal Bouquet, Grooms Boutinierre, 6 GM, FOB and FOG Boutinierres, Mini bouquet for the flower girl, MOB and MOG, 18 centerpieces - 2 mason jars on each table, one pint, one quart, Moss squaes on each table, 6 additional mason jars for the cocktail tables, bar and bathrooms, 6 sheperd hooks with mason jars for the ceremony.

    When we were at about $1500 we were using garden roses, hydrangeas and some hypericum berries. However, I love  David Austin roses (which I found otu after are the most expensive garden rose) so we are adding some of those in as well as some ranunculus. Also, at the lower price we were doing 1 mason jar per table and none in the cocktail hour so that also drove up the price.
